A full-time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) position is available to provide specialized support in a school setting in the Pittston, PA area. This contract role offers 35 hours per week with flexibility to consider part-time candidates. The assignment begins ASAP and continues until August 7, 2026, covering maternity leaves in Lackawanna County initially, then supporting itinerant students in the Dunmore, PA area during the spring.

Key qualifications include:

  • Valid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C) in Speech-Language Pathology
  • Active Pennsylvania SLP licensure
  • Experience working in school-based settings
  • Ability to obtain and maintain Pennsylvania clearances for school employment
  • Reliable transportation is essential for traveling between locations

Responsibilities include:

  • Delivering evaluation, diagnosis, and individualized therapy services to students in accordance with school district guidelines
  • Collaborating with educators, parents, and other professionals to support student communication goals
  • Maintaining accurate and timely documentation of services rendered
  • Participating in team meetings and professional development sessions as required

This position requires onsite work with no teletherapy options allowed. Interviews will be conducted via Zoom to facilitate the selection process.
